GIADA'S PEPPERMINT-CHOCOLATE SANDWICH COOKIES



Giada's Peppermint-Chocolate Sandwich Cookies image

I found this recipe on foodnetwork.com's 12 Days of Cookies 2008. Giada's Peppermint-Chocolate Sandwich Cookies are built around store bought sugar cookie dough, which makes it a great recipe to whip up with kids. These cookies have a chocolate-peppermint center and then are topped with chocolate and sprinkled with crushed peppermint. Recipe courtesy of Giada De Laurentis. Please note: time does NOT include chill time. Update: I used a 2" round biscuit cutter and was able to get 20 cookies from the batch. I also found it easier to spread the melted chocolate on the top of the cookies with the back of a spoon than to dip the cookies into the chocolate.

Categories     Dessert

Time 30m

Yield 12 sandwich cookies

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 (16 1/2 ounce) package refrigerated sugar cookie dough
1/4 cup all-purpose flour, plus extra for dusting
2 cups semi-sweet chocolate chips, divided
1/4 cup heavy cream
1 teaspoon pure peppermint extract
1 teaspoon vegetable oil
crushed candy canes or peppermint candy

Steps:

  • Position oven rack in the lower third of the oven.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per. In a medium bowl, knead together the cookie dough and 1/4 cup flour until smooth. Lightly flour a work surface. Roll out the dough to a 1/4-inch thick. Using a 2 1/2-inch cookie cutter, cut out circles from the dough. Knead together any scrapes of dough and roll out again. Continue to cut out pastry circles until there re 24 pieces in total. Place the dough circles on the prepared baking sheets. Bake until the cookies are slightly golden around the edges, about 10 minutes. Cool for 10 minutes and transfer to a wire rack to cool completely. Reserve 1 parchment paper-lined baking sheet.
  • Combine 1 cup of chocolate chips and the cream in a small saucepan. Place the small saucepan over a medium pan of simmering water until the chocolate has melted and the mixture is smooth. Whisk in the peppermint extract and refrigerate the mixture for 1 hour. Using a 1/2-ounce cookie scoop or a tablespoon measure, place the chocolate mixture in the center of the flat side of 12 cookies. Place the remaining cookies on top and gently squeeze to distribute the filling evenly. Place on a baking sheet and freeze until the filling has set, about 25 minutes.
  • Combine the remaining chocolate chips and the vegetable oil in a small saucepan. Once again, place the small saucepan over a medium pan of simmering water until the chocolate has melted and the mixture is smooth. Dip the top of each cookie in the melted chocolate and return to the baking sheet. Sprinkle the tops with crushed candy canes or crushed peppermint candies. Refrigerate until firm, about 1 hour. Store in an airtight plastic container.
  • If you prefer, you can use white, red an green sprinkles or red and green decorating sugar in place of the crushed peppermint candies.

CHOCOLATE SANDWICH COOKIES

Categories     dessert

Time 1h29m

Yield 12 sandwich cookies

Number Of Ingredients 16

1 cup plus 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1/3 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on fine sea salt
1/2 cup (1 stick) unsalted butter, at room temperature
1/2 packed cup light brown sugar
1/2 cup sugar
1 large egg, at room temperature
1/2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
1 heaped cup (6 ounces) 60 percent cacao bittersweet chocolate chips (recommended: Ghirardelli)
4 ounces cream cheese, at room temperature
2 1/2 cups powdered sugar
1/2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
Assorted food coloring, optional
Water, as needed

Steps:

  • Cookies: Put an oven rack in the center of the oven. Preheat the oven to 325 degrees F.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per or silicone mats. Set aside.
  • In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Using an electric stand mixer fitted with a paddle attachment, beat the butter and sugars together until fluffy. Beat in the egg and vanilla. With the machine running, gradually add the flour mixture until just blended. Stir in the chocolate chips. Using a 1-ounce ice cream or cookie scoop, form 12 equal-sized pieces of dough onto each baking sheet. With damp hands, form the dough into balls. Flatten the tops of the dough slightly and bake until the tops of the cookies begin to crack slightly, about 14 minutes. Cool for 5 minutes. Transfer the cookies to a wire rack to cool completely, about 20 minutes.
  • Filling: In a medium bowl, using an electric mixer, beat the cream cheese and vanilla together until fluffy. Gradually add the powdered sugar and mix until smooth. Color the frosting by mixing in the food coloring, 1 drop of at a time, until the desired color is reached. Add water, if needed, 1/2 teaspoon at a time, to make the consistency spreadable.
  • Spread the frosting on the flat side of half of the cookies and put the remaining cookies on top. Refrigerate for 30 minutes to allow the filling to stiffen slightly. Serve at room temperature.

PEPPERMINT PATTY SANDWICH COOKIES

Categories     dessert

Time 30m

Yield 15 servings

Number Of Ingredients 15

4 ounces bittersweet chocolate, chopped
3 sticks (1 1/2 cups) butter, at room temperature
1 cup flour
1/2 cup cocoa powder
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 cup light brown sugar
1/2 cup granulated sugar
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
1/4 teaspoon salt
2 eggs, at room temperature
1/4 cup plain yogurt
3 cups confectioners' sugar
1/4 teaspoon peppermint extract
10 chocolate-coated peppermint candies, such as York Peppermint Patties, chopped
5 candy canes, crushed, optional

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F. Line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
  • Melt the chocolate and 1 stick of the butter over medium heat in a double boiler. Remove from the heat and set aside to cool slightly.
  • In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, cocoa powder and baking powder. Set aside.
  • To the bowl with the melted chocolate, add the brown sugar, granulated sugar, vanilla and salt. Whisk to combine. Whisk in the eggs, one at a time, followed by the yogurt. Using a rubber spatula, fold in the flour mixture being careful to avoid over-mixing.
  • Scoop 1-tablespoon mounds of the batter on the prepared baking sheets, leaving about 1-inch between each cookie. Bake the cookies for about 9 minutes, rotating the trays halfway through. Slide the cookies on the parchment onto a cooling rack and cool completely.
  • Meanwhile make the filling. In a medium bowl, use an electric hand mixer to beat the remaining 2 sticks butter and the confectioners' sugar; mix until light and fluffy, starting on low speed to avoid splatter and work up to medium speed, 3 minutes. Add the peppermint extract, salt and peppermint candies. Beat on medium speed until the candies are broken apart and evenly distributed, 2 minutes.
  • Spread the filling on the flat side of half of the cookies. Top with the remaining cookies. Roll the edges in the crushed candy canes if using and serve immediately or store in an airtight container until ready to serve.

ITALIAN CHOCOLATE SANDWICH COOKIE

Categories     dessert

Time 1h5m

Yield 28 cookies

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 cup unsalted butter, room temperature (2 sticks)
2/3 cup sugar
1 cup all-purpose flour
1 cup cornmeal or polenta
1/3 cup cocoa powder
1 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 orange, zested
1/2 cup unsalted butter, room temperature (1 stick)
3/4 cup powdered sugar
1/2 orange, zested
Pinch salt

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
  • To make the Chocolate Cookies, in a large bowl use an electric mixer to cream together the butter and sugar until light in color and fluffy. In another medium bowl stir together the flour, cornmeal or polenta, cocoa powder, baking powder, salt, and orange zest. Add the dry ingredients to the butter mixture and stir to combine using a wooden spoon. Place the dough on a sheet of plastic wrap. Press the dough into a 1-inch high round. Wrap in pl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es and up to 1 day.
  • Roll out the dough to between 1/8 and 1/4-inch thick. Use a 1 3/4-inch round cookie cutter to cut out the dough. Bake on a heavy baking sheet for 15 minutes. Place the baking sheets on a wire rack to cool cookies.
  • Meanwhile, to make the Orange Filling, combine the butter, powdered sugar, orange zest, and salt in a medium bowl. Use an electric mixer to cream the ingredients together.
  • To assemble the cookie sandwiches, place about 1 teaspoon of the Orange Filling on a cookie. Top with another cookie and press the cookies together. Store in an airtight container for up to 1 day.

CHOCOLATE ALMOND SANDWICH COOKIES

Categories     dessert

Time 1h50m

Yield 15 sandwich cookies

Number Of Ingredients 15

1 cup roasted smooth unsalted almond butter
1 cup coconut sugar
4 tablespoons (1/2 stick) unsalted butter, at room temperature
1/4 cup cocoa powder, such as Scharffenberger
1 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on pure almond extract
1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
2 large eggs, at room temperature
2 cups instant rolled oats
3/4 cup mini chocolate chips
8 ounces (1 block) cream cheese, at room temperature
1/2 cup powdered sugar
4 tablespoons (1/2 stick) unsalted butter, at room temperature
3 tablespoons cocoa powder, such as Scharffenberger
Pinch of kosher salt

Steps:

  • For the sandwich cookies: In a large bowl, combine the almond butter, coconut sugar and butter. Using a handheld mixer, beat on medium speed until light and fluffy, about 3 minutes. Add the cocoa powder, baking soda, almond extract, salt and eggs and mix to combine. Fold in the oats and mini chocolate chips. Cover and refrigerate the dough for 1 hour.
  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Line 2 rimmed baking sheets with parchment paper.
  • Scoop 15 heaping tablespoon-size rounds of dough 1 inch apart on each prepared baking sheet. Bake, rotating the baking sheets halfway through, until the cookies are just set around the edges and still soft in the middle, 10 to 11 minutes. Allow to cool for 10 minutes on the baking sheets before removing to a wire rack to cool completely.
  • For the filling: In a medium bowl, combine the cream cheese, powdered sugar, butter, cocoa powder and salt. Using a handheld mixer, beat on medium speed until light and fluffy, about 3 minutes.
  • Spread a heaping tablespoon of the filling on the flat side of half of the cooled cookies. Sandwich the remaining half of the cookies, flat side against the filling. Store in the refrigerator and remove 30 minutes before serving.
